Circuit 8 Revitalization Project – Final Phase

 

Thanks to support from the Young Family Foundation, the final phase of the Circuit 8 Revitalization is underway led by Digger.  A restorative journey over the past 5 years, the trail will serve beginners and intermediates to take advantage of what is the lowest grade trail zone on the Shore.  The goal is to give an introductory zone to children and beginners in an easy access area that will encourage their participation in the sport of mountain biking and all the positive benefits that go along with it.  The work commencing this March will build upon the work supported by the Yound Foundations in 2014.

Legacy Fund Complete

The NSMBA is proud to announce that we have reached our $15,000 goal, which will be matched for a total of $30,000 going back into the trails. We are grateful for your contribution and support as it allows us to continue to make improvements and expand our existing network for the community.
